I'll anwser the first question It's a male rainbow trout and the smaller one is female brown trout the males as they mature the jaws get long and curl simular to a salmon. Here in Ct there 5 trophy trout lakes all have a 2 trout limit that has a 16" min size all other must be released. This place is only 200 acres but around 1900 this was a stone quarry that they struck so much water that the place filled up to a depth of 55 feet and along the south side with a depthfinder there is the last place that was worked there is a vertical wall that goes from 53' to 13' in less than 10 '.
